Summary
Motherwell writes that he has found someone who may give Baziotes a contract and advises that they may need to find other representation because Peggy Guggenheim may close her gallery.
Back of letter has abstract sketches.
Back of envelope has two faces sketched on it, one of which appears to be a self-portrait by Motherwell.
